我从 GoDaddy 更新了我的证书并拿回了两个文件:
gd_bundle-g2-g1.crt
27ec89cfaa7c28.crt
我有private.key
。
但是我完全忘记了如何使用或生成.pem
与 HAProxy 一起使用的有效文件,我当前的配置行如下:
bind :443 ssl crt /home/ubuntu/ssl/site.pem ciphers ECDHE-RSA-AES256-SHA:RC4-SHA:RC4:HIGH:!MD5:!aNULL:!EDH:!AESGCM
我猜它肯定是无密码的。我尝试查找有关此信息,但一无所获。
有哪位好心人可以告诉我应该如何连接这些文件以使 HAProxy 正常工作?
答案1
我以前遇到过 pem 文件问题。密钥和 crt 文件在 pem 文件中的列出顺序似乎很重要。使用 cat example.com.crt example.com.key > example.com.pem 创建新的 pem 文件,而不是使用提供的文件。